Overview of noun fitting
The noun fitting has 4 senses (no senses from tagged texts)
1. adjustment, accommodation, fitting -- (making or becoming suitable; adjusting to circumstances)
2. fitting -- (a small and often standardized accessory to a larger system)
3. appointment, fitting -- ((usually plural) furnishings and equipment (especially for a ship or hotel))
4. fitting, try-on, trying on -- (putting clothes on to see whether they fit)
Overview of verb fit
The verb fit has 9 senses (first 8 from tagged texts)
1. (14) suit, accommodate, fit -- (be agreeable or acceptable to; "This suits my needs")
2. (11) fit, go -- (be the right size or shape; fit correctly or as desired; "This piece won't fit into the puzzle")
3. (9) meet, fit, conform to -- (satisfy a condition or restriction; "Does this paper meet the requirements for the degree?")
4. (7) fit -- (make fit; "fit a dress"; "He fitted other pieces of paper to his cut-out")
5. (5) fit -- (insert or adjust several objects or people; "Can you fit the toy into the box?"; "This man can't fit himself into our work environment")
6. (4) match, fit, correspond, check, jibe, gibe, tally, agree -- (be compatible, similar or consistent; coincide in their characteristics; "The two stories don't agree in many details"; "The handwriting checks with the signature on the check"; "The suspect's fingerprints don't match those on the gun")
7. (1) fit -- (conform to some shape or size; "How does this shirt fit?")
8. (1) equip, fit, fit out, outfit -- (provide with (something) usually for a specific purpose; "The expedition was equipped with proper clothing, food, and other necessities")
9. match, fit -- (make correspond or harmonize; "Match my sweater")
Overview of adj fitting
The adj fitting has 2 senses (first 2 from tagged texts)
1. (5) fitting -- (in harmony with the spirit of particular persons or occasion; "We have come to dedicate a portion of that field...It is altogether fitting and proper that we should do this")
2. (2) fitting, meet -- (being precisely fitting and right; "it is only meet that she should be seated first")
